ESC Speech Pathology Webinar Series
Pixels, Play, and Progress: Harnessing digital tools to support communication growth




This interactive webinar series has proven to be an excellent source of continuing education for many speech pathologists and other school staff since 2012. In this series, we are once again offering high-quality learning opportunities, so speech pathologists and speech pathology assistants can improve upon their existing skill set. Developed through the thoughtful collaboration of ALL twenty education service centers, we have secured respected presenters to deliver timely and high-level learning topics, all conveniently delivered to your computer/device.  The more informed you are, the better prepared you are to serve your students.  Join us throughout the school year for any one, a few, or all of our SLP webinars.


Important Session Information:


This session is designed for 21st-century speech-language pathologists working with school-age children and adolescents who experience communication challenges, including social pragmatic differences and stuttering. From pixel-packed games to interactive apps and websites, today’s digital tools open up fresh, engaging possibilities for therapy that can boost motivation and participation. Through lively discussion and hands-on demonstrations, participants will discover how to weave fun, functional, and evidence-supported digital experiences into their sessions to create space for connection, growth, and plenty of meaningful play.
